The post-holder will be responsible for effectively contributing to the work of the technical department, ensuring that effective technical service to the site is maintained and developed. The post holder will also be responsible for monitoring the factory quality & food safety systems and for determining that quality, safety, and legality are met at each stage of the process by liaising effectively with all relevant parties in a policing capacity.
The main responsibilities of the role are:
- Maintaining the Food Safety System policies and procedures
- HACCP Studies
- Document Control
- Coordination of internal audits and distributing the results and ensuring all corrective actions are completed
- Collecting micro samples as per schedule
- Traceability
- Investigations into complaints
- Daily auditing of CCPs
- Daily label checks
- Calibration
- Auditing of processing records
- GMP/Fabric audits
- Temperature checks
- Quality checks
The nature of the role requires a flexible approach to working hours. Core working hours are: Nights: Monday to Friday 20.00 to 06.00.
